The Hidden Physics: Force Testing & Safety Compliance

An automated gate isn’t just a regular gate with a motor attached; it is legally classified as a machine. Under UK safety regulations, these machines must meet strict safety compliance standards to ensure they do not pose a danger to users, pedestrians, or vehicles.

Professionals use highly specialised diagnostic equipment to conduct official force testing. This ensures that if the gate encounters an obstacle (like a car or, worse, a person), it will instantly detect the resistance and reverse safely. A DIY installation lacks this critical calibration, leaving you exposed to severe safety liabilities if an accident occurs.

Geometry and Weight Distribution

The mechanics behind a smoothly operating gate rely on precise geometry.

  • Swing Gates: Must be perfectly balanced to prevent unnecessary strain on the rams or underground motors.

  • Sliding Gates: Require a perfectly level track or a meticulously engineered cantilever system to slide effortlessly.

If the alignment is off by even a few millimetres, the motors have to work twice as hard. This drastically shortens the lifespan of premium components from trusted brands like DEA or Beninca, leading to premature motor failure and costly replacement parts.

Smart Access Control Integration

Modern gate automation relies heavily on seamless integration with digital access technology. Setting up wireless intercoms, keypad codes, and smartphone app control requires advanced electrical and programming knowledge.

A specialist ensures your system is correctly wired, safely grounded, and securely connected to your network, preventing glitches, dropped connections, or security vulnerabilities that tech-savvy intruders could exploit.

Protecting Your Investment and Warranty

Premium automation hardware comes with robust manufacturer warranties, but these are almost always conditional on professional installation. Attempting to install or service the kit yourself can instantly void your warranty.

When you work with an accredited expert, your equipment is fully protected, and you gain the peace of mind that comes with reliable, ongoing maintenance support.
